    Zendaya as Cinderella (2019)

    This moment went viral due to Zendaya's spectacular transformation into Cinderella, featuring a dress that lit up and changed on the red carpet. The theatricality and Disney homage, along with the interaction with her stylist Law Roach as her fairy godmother, created an unforgettable and widely shared social media experience.

    Tyla and her Sand Dress (2024)

    Tyla's sand dress at the 2024 Met Gala became a viral phenomenon due to its originality and the logistical challenge it presented. Its unique design, made from real sand and sculpted to her body, generated massive conversation across social media and news outlets. The necessity of cutting it at the event to allow Tyla to move added a dramatic and memorable element that captured global attention.

    Doja Cat as Choupette (2023)

    Doja Cat's appearance as Choupette at the 2023 Met Gala generated massive media impact, instantly becoming a viral phenomenon. Her commitment to the character, including prosthetics and meowing on the red carpet, made her stand out and be widely shared across social media.

    Lady Gaga's striptease (2019)

    Lady Gaga's performance at the 2019 Met Gala was a display of fashion and theatricality that captured global attention, featuring four costume changes culminating in a daring lingerie ensemble. This moment became an instant viral phenomenon, generating countless headlines and discussions for its audacity and its perfect embodiment of the "Camp" theme.

    Rihanna's Yellow Guo Pei Gown (2015)

    This moment went viral due to the sheer scale and visual impact of Guo Pei's yellow dress, which sparked an avalanche of memes and social media conversations. Rihanna's bold choice and the garment's exceptional craftsmanship made it an instant cultural phenomenon, solidifying her status as a fashion icon.

    Jeremy Pope and his Karl Lagerfeld face cape (2023)

    Jeremy Pope's outfit at the 2023 Met Gala created a massive visual impact, featuring a 30-foot cape adorned with Karl Lagerfeld's face. This bold and theatrical design instantly went viral, dominating social media and fashion headlines. His wardrobe choice was a direct and memorable homage to the gala's theme, capturing global attention for its originality and scale.
